Best Practices for Android Device Security
Effective Android device security necessitates businesses to follow specific key best practices. These practices help improve the security of both individual devices and the overall digital ecosystem:
Keep Software Updated
Operating system and application updates should become a habit since they help protect devices from previously known vulnerabilities. Through Android device management businesses can implement automatic update processes which maintain continuous operation of current security patches.
Enable Encryption
By encrypting Android device data you improve security when a device gets lost or stolen. Secure data transmission is ensured because unauthorized readers need an exact decryption key to decode the material.
Use Multi-Factor Authentication
Organizations can enhance security through Multi-factor Authentication (MFA) which demands various authentication methods for accessing sensitive data or systems. The application of multi-factor authentication processes successfully decreases the risks of unauthorized system access.
Monitor Device Activity
System activity monitoring empowers organizations to spot suspicious device actions which suggest potential violations of security protocols. Through their device management software systems administrators can monitor all user interactions including software installations and data exchange along with network connection logs.
Control App Installation
Businesses that implement controls on unauthorized app installations create fewer vulnerabilities for their devices to experience cyber attacks. Businesses control what apps get installed on Android devices using device management tools to maintain only authorized secure applications.
Remote Data Wipe
When your device disappears or someone takes it away from you the ability to initiate remote data wipe ensures complete data destruction to stop unauthorized access. Through Android device management features administrators gain the ability to remotely delete compromised device data.
